Menü

Login

Aktuelle Version

Forum > 1.2.7php5 Probleme beim Sitzplan erstellen/ändern *

DOTLAN Intranet / Portal >> Probleme und Fehler > 1.2.7php5 Probleme beim Sitzplan erstellen/ändern
Antwort erstellen
Autor Thema: 1.2.7php5 Probleme beim Sitzplan erstellen/ändern
[LF]Demonhunter
12.01.2009 um 00:35 QuoteProfileSend PM
NEW

Clan: LANd-Forces e.V.
Postings: 173

[LF]Demonhunter
Huhu Leutz, endlich probiere ich mich mal an einer neuen Version... so hier und da mal geklickt und siehe da... ein Fehler!

Also: Ich kann als globaler Admin eigentlich alles machen, wenn ich jedoch einen neuen Sitzplan erstellen will, klicke ich mir da was zusammen (einen Tisch irgendwo hin reicht zum testen!), gebe einen Namen ein und klicke auf "speichern":

Zitat:
Dies ist ein geschützer Bereich. Dir fehlen die entsprechenden Zugriffs- oder Administrationsrechte um diesen Bereich zu betreten. Bei Fragen wende dich an den zuständigen Administrator.


Oben rechts steht auch nicht mehr "[ 1 ] Online Demonhunter Admin Logout", sondern "[ 2 ] Online Login".

Mal das debugging angemacht, aber ich kann nix erkennen... Hier die ausgabe:
Zitat:
found 62 debug messages
tstamp - class::function -> message
---------------------------------------------------------------------------------------
0.000198 - GLOBAL::include -> config.php
0.004356 - GLOBAL::include -> db_mysql.php
0.007103 - DATABASE::connect -> mysql_connect >localhost, waynesworld<
0.019128 - GLOBAL::include -> class.html.php
0.030756 - GLOBAL::include -> class.page.php
0.035249 - GLOBAL::include -> class.session.php
0.043843 - GLOBAL::include -> class.user.php
0.048825 - GLOBAL::include -> class.admin.php
0.051054 - GLOBAL::include -> class.styles.php
0.052301 - GLOBAL::include -> class.encryption.php
0.054730 - SESSION::start_session -> ---- init
0.055042 - SESSION::start_session -> start php4 session managment
0.056024 - SESSION::start_session -> finished php4 session managment
0.056238 - SESSION::start_session -> save user and host information to new session_array
0.064082 - SESSION::register -> register session variable: session
0.064314 - SESSION::start_session -> check for security options
0.064499 - SESSION::generate_urlhash -> url without s=XXX
0.064679 - SESSION::start_session -> update current session online user infos
0.064973 - DATABASE::query -> <b>UPDATE session SET lastactivity=1231713487, userid=0, nick='', site='http://www.waynesworld-lan.de/dotlan/admin/?do=sitzplan_layout_save&id=1', hits=hits+1 WHERE hash='e5u4upo9d24l8ntee6pff8oqt5sn1hte' </b>
0.066083 - SESSION::start_session -> no session found in db == insert new db sesssion
0.066291 - DATABASE::query -> <b>SELECT COUNT(hash) FROM session WHERE hash='e5u4upo9d24l8ntee6pff8oqt5sn1hte' </b>
0.067645 - DATABASE::query -> <b>SELECT code FROM `country_ip2code` WHERE ip_from<=inet_aton('84.62.186.131') AND ip_to>=inet_aton('84.62.186.131')</b>
0.068638 - SESSION::register -> register session variable: session
0.069078 - DATABASE::query -> <b>INSERT INTO session (hash,userid,nick,host,dns,site,useragent,lastactivity,referer,hits,countrycode) VALUES ('e5u4upo9d24l8ntee6pff8oqt5sn1hte',0,'','84.62.186.131','dslb-084-062-186-131.pools.arcor-ip.net','http://www.waynesworld-lan.de/dotlan/admin/?do=sitzplan_layout_save&id=1','Mozilla/5.0 (Windows; U; Windows NT 5.1; de; rv:1.9.0.5) Gecko/2008120122 Firefox/3.0.5','1231713487','http://www.waynesworld-lan.de/dotlan/admin/?do=sitzplan_layout&id=1',0,'')</b>
0.070203 - SESSION::generate_urlhash -> url without s=XXX
0.071372 - SESSION::load_locales -> chosing language for locales: de_DE
0.071544 - SESSION::start_session -> ---- finished with session startup
0.071808 - STYLE::init -> name: >dotlan-bf<
0.071957 - STYLE::get_style -> name: >dotlan-bf<
0.072188 - STYLE::include -> /srv/www/waynesworld-lan.de/public_html/dotlan/html/styles/dotlan-bf.php
0.076697 - USER::load_settings -> load current user settings to $global
0.077040 - GLOBAL::include -> class.prvmsg.php
0.078888 - GLOBAL::include -> class.event.php
0.083766 - EVENT::comming_event -> return
0.083979 - DATABASE::query -> <b>SELECT id FROM events WHERE UNIX_TIMESTAMP(end) > 1231713487 AND active=1 ORDER by begin ASC</b>
0.085230 - GLOBAL::include -> class.sitzplan.php
0.094433 - GLOBAL::end global.php -> ---------------------------------------------
0.094832 - ADMIN::include -> class.admin_sitzplan.php
0.107900 - GLOBAL::include -> class.sitzplan_frontend.php
0.135951 - SITZPLAN_FRONTEND::constructor -> load object variables from a given object
0.136972 - ADMIN::check -> check for adminright: >1<
0.137248 - HTML::gettemplate -> template: >error_nopermission< QUERY Filesystem
0.137601 - HTML::gettemplate -> read: /srv/www/waynesworld-lan.de/public_html/dotlan/html/templates/default/error/error_nopermission.tpl
0.138248 - HTML::gettemplate -> template: >error< QUERY Filesystem
0.138547 - HTML::gettemplate -> read: /srv/www/waynesworld-lan.de/public_html/dotlan/html/templates/dotlan-bf/error.tpl
0.139569 - GLOBAL::end userspace -> ---------------------------------------------
0.139726 - PAGE::render -> start rendering page layout
0.139993 - USER::check_for_new_messages -> return
0.140210 - HTML::gettemplate -> template: >page_sitetitle< QUERY Filesystem
0.140482 - HTML::gettemplate -> read: /srv/www/waynesworld-lan.de/public_html/dotlan/html/templates/dotlan-bf/page_sitetitle.tpl
0.142989 - HTML::gettemplate -> template: >page_topbanner< QUERY Filesystem
0.143293 - HTML::gettemplate -> read: /srv/www/waynesworld-lan.de/public_html/dotlan/html/templates/dotlan-bf/page_topbanner.tpl
0.143930 - PAGE::get_shortmenu -> return
0.144529 - HTML::gettemplate -> template: >page_shortmenu< QUERY Filesystem
0.144814 - HTML::gettemplate -> read: /srv/www/waynesworld-lan.de/public_html/dotlan/html/templates/dotlan-bf/page_shortmenu.tpl
0.146646 - HTML::gettemplate -> template: >page_content< QUERY Filesystem
0.146959 - HTML::gettemplate -> read: /srv/www/waynesworld-lan.de/public_html/dotlan/html/templates/dotlan-bf/page_content.tpl
0.147891 - HTML::gettemplate -> template: >page_impressum< QUERY Filesystem
0.148210 - HTML::gettemplate -> read: /srv/www/waynesworld-lan.de/public_html/dotlan/html/templates/default/page/page_impressum.tpl
0.148958 - HTML::gettemplate -> template: >page< QUERY Filesystem
0.149261 - HTML::gettemplate -> read: /srv/www/waynesworld-lan.de/public_html/dotlan/html/templates/dotlan-bf/page.tpl
0.150806 - PAGE::render -> final

PHP Includes : 17
DB Queries : 5
Templates used : 8
Varcache used : 0
PHP Memory Usage : 3.557.760 Bytes
Content-Size : 5.994 Bytes (w/o debug)
Rendering Time : 0.152533

Includes PHP Files:
- /srv/www/waynesworld-lan.de/public_html/dotlan/admin/index.php
- /srv/www/waynesworld-lan.de/public_html/dotlan/global.php
- /srv/www/waynesworld-lan.de/public_html/dotlan/config.php
- /srv/www/waynesworld-lan.de/public_html/dotlan/includes/db_mysql.php
- /srv/www/waynesworld-lan.de/public_html/dotlan/includes/class.html.php
- /srv/www/waynesworld-lan.de/public_html/dotlan/includes/class.page.php
- /srv/www/waynesworld-lan.de/public_html/dotlan/includes/class.session.php
- /srv/www/waynesworld-lan.de/public_html/dotlan/includes/class.user.php
- /srv/www/waynesworld-lan.de/public_html/dotlan/includes/class.admin.php
- /srv/www/waynesworld-lan.de/public_html/dotlan/includes/class.styles.php
- /srv/www/waynesworld-lan.de/public_html/dotlan/includes/class.encryption.php
- /srv/www/waynesworld-lan.de/public_html/dotlan/html/styles/dotlan-bf.php
- /srv/www/waynesworld-lan.de/public_html/dotlan/includes/class.prvmsg.php
- /srv/www/waynesworld-lan.de/public_html/dotlan/includes/class.event.php
- /srv/www/waynesworld-lan.de/public_html/dotlan/includes/class.sitzplan.php
- /srv/www/waynesworld-lan.de/public_html/dotlan/includes/class.admin_sitzplan.php
- /srv/www/waynesworld-lan.de/public_html/dotlan/includes/class.sitzplan_frontend.php

Used Templates:
- error
- error_nopermission
- page
- page_content
- page_impressum
- page_shortmenu
- page_sitetitle
- page_topbanner


Bin wegen der "PHP4-Session sammeln" etwas verdutzt, weil PHP5-version auf einem PHP5-Server, aber naja... Was habe ich übersehen? Hmmmm...
__________________
[LF]Demonhunter
Team LANd-Forces e.V.
LAN-Partys im Ruhrgebiet


 
Sorehead
12.01.2009 um 09:49 QuoteProfileSend PM
NEW

Clan: Gamesession Hannover
Postings: 348

Also ich nutze die gleiche Version.. Bei mir klappt das. Bist du sicher dass du alle includes richtig ausgetauscht hast?
 
[LF]Demonhunter
12.01.2009 um 14:12 QuoteProfileSend PM
NEW

Clan: LANd-Forces e.V.
Postings: 173

[LF]Demonhunter
Ich habe das zip Archiv genommen, es war niemals eine 4-er Version drauf!
__________________
[LF]Demonhunter
Team LANd-Forces e.V.
LAN-Partys im Ruhrgebiet


 
Bigga
12.01.2009 um 15:49 QuoteProfileSend PM
NEW

Clan: KST-LAN
Postings: 418

Kann ich unter PHP4 nicht bestätigen.
 
[LF]Demonhunter
14.01.2009 um 01:08 QuoteProfileSend PM
NEW

Clan: LANd-Forces e.V.
Postings: 173

[LF]Demonhunter
So, nochmal ganz in Ruhe alles neu installiert... gleicher Fehler - was habe ich übersehen... Zend-Version o.ä.?
__________________
[LF]Demonhunter
Team LANd-Forces e.V.
LAN-Partys im Ruhrgebiet


 
Griffon
14.01.2009 um 21:56 QuoteProfileSend PM

NEW

Clan: dotlan.net
Postings: 1252

das mit "php4 sesssion" kommt bestimmt daher, weil ich das damals per hand da rein geschrieben habe, als debug text. Und zu dem Zeitpunkt gab es noch kein php5 :-P

Aber das Problem das du hast ist ein ganz anderes. Ich war auch erst wieder am überlegen, bis es mir eingefallen ist.

Du hast SUHOSIN laufen als PHP extentions. Sobald die Anzahl an übertragenen Feldern in einem HTML Formular zu groß wird, greifen die komischen Sicherheits Features und begrenzen diese. Dadurch kommen nicht alle Daten bei der PHP Anwendung an. Dies geht sogar soweit, das die Session Daten sowie Cookie Daten flöten gehen beim Transport und die Anwendung denkt du bist ausgeloggt und geht erst nicht in die Applikation rein.

Werf Suhosin raus oder stell es so ein, das es zur Webseite passt.

Sehr häufig ist die Folgende Einstellung das Problem: suhosin.post.max_array_index_length=64

Aber ich habe mich selbst noch nicht mit Suhosin beschäftigt.

Viel Erfolg beim testen.

[Editiert von Griffon am 14.Jan.2009 um 21:56]
 
[ Antwort erstellen ]